3. Speed Control: Your Only Lever of Influence
The speed setting is the sole parameter you can adjust before launch. Choosing between Turbo, Fast, Normal, or Slow changes how quickly multipliers accumulate and how many rockets you’ll likely encounter.
Here’s a quick glance at what each speed offers:
- Turbo: Highest risk, fastest multiplier growth; rockets appear more frequently.
- Fast: Balanced risk; moderate multiplier pace.
- Normal: Default; safe enough for newcomers yet still rewarding.
- Slow: Lowest risk; longer flight times but fewer rockets.
Most casual players default to Normal speed to see how the game feels, while experienced users often experiment with Turbo to chase higher multipliers during short bursts.
Because you can switch speeds during a session—before each new flight—you’re always in control of how aggressive you want your next round to be.

4. Multipliers and Rockets: The Heartbeat of Risk
The counter balance displays your current potential win above the aircraft. As multipliers appear—+1, +2, +5, +10 or x2, x3, x4, x5—the numbers climb rapidly.
Rockets are the game’s unique twist: each rocket that appears splits your collected amount in half and lowers the plane’s trajectory, adding another layer of tension.

8. Common Mistakes in High‑Intensity Play
Avoiding pitfalls keeps your experience enjoyable even when sessions are packed with fast rounds:
- Chasing losses: Raising bets after a streak of losses only amplifies risk; stick to your pre‑set bet amount.
- Mistaking RTP for guaranteed wins: A 97% RTP is an average over millions of rounds—not your single session outcome.
- Panic during rocket hits: A rocket halves your win but doesn’t mean you should quit; simply accept it as part of the risk profile.
